After four successful cohorts, The Legal Innovation Zone (LIZ) at Toronto Metropolitan University (TMU) is now accepting applications for their fifth cohort of Concept Framework. Running from March 28th to May 9th, this program helps aspiring entrepreneurs in the legal tech industry turn their ideas into proof of concept.

Concept Framework is a free six-week, part-time, interactive program that invites legal innovators, nationally and internationally, to explore what it takes to build a legal tech company. Through engaging, interactive content and ongoing mentorship, entrepreneurs are challenged to put their ideas to the test. 

Participants will get the opportunity to validate their concept, develop key messaging, and understand their customer base. They will also get the opportunity to do some prototyping, creating a Minimum Viable Design, begin creating a sustainable business model and develop an execution strategy to set them and their business up for success. 

Since launching the first cohort in 2019, Concept Framework has helped advance and develop fifty-two legal tech startups from over thirteen countries. “One of the most intimidating parts of starting a successful business is taking your theoretical idea out of your mind and into reality,” says Hersh Perlis, Director of the LIZ. “Concept Framework is a program to help aspiring entrepreneurs do just that. Through ongoing mentorship, expert guidance, and engaging online content, Concept Framework gives legal tech entrepreneurs a better idea how to turn their ideas into a business.”

 

Concept Framework Program Breakdown

Concept Validation

What problem are you trying to solve? Fall in love with solving the problem with a focus on the consumer.

Customer Development

Who is your ideal customer? Understand who you’re selling the solution to and how to build a user base.

Prototyping

What will your solution look like? Create a Minimum Viable Design - without being a technical expert.

Storytelling

How are you going to present your business to the world? Develop your key messaging to win early supporters.

Business Modelling

How can you set yourself up for success? Learn key considerations to build a sustainable business model.

Setting up for Success

Where do you go from here? Develop a clear execution strategy to move you forward after completing the program.
